Abstract
In the original article, the Abstract contained a typographic error for the total number of men assigned to the surgery group (346 instead of 364). The correct number of 364 is listed in Table 1 and Fig. 3. The corrected sentence in the Abstract should therefore read as follows: Results and limitations: During 22.1 yr (median follow-up for survivors = 18.6 yr; interquartile range: 16.6–20.0), 515 men died; 246 of 364 men (68%) were assigned to surgery versus 269 of 367 (73%) assigned to observation (hazard ratio 0.84 [95% confidence interval {CI}: 0.70–1.00]; p = 0.044 [absolute risk reduction = 5.7 percentage points, 95%CI: –0.89 to 12%]; relative risk: 0.92 [95% CI: 0.84–1.01]).
